III. Meeting Woodworking Design Requirements
In woodworking, design is key. The CNC Cutting Machine enables woodworkers to bring their most creative and detailed designs to life. It can accurately cut and shape wood according to digital blueprints, ensuring consistency and accuracy. Whether it’s creating curved edges, intricate joinery, or decorative inlays, the precision of the CNC machine is unmatched. This is especially important in high-end furniture making and architectural woodwork, where even the slightest deviation can affect the overall quality and appearance of the final product. The machine can also be programmed to make repeatable cuts, which is beneficial for mass production of wood components with the same design.
IV. Improving Efficiency and Reducing Waste
Efficiency is a crucial factor in any woodworking operation. The CNC Cutting Machine optimizes the use of wood materials. By precisely calculating and executing cuts, it minimizes waste. This is not only environmentally friendly but also cost-effective. The machine can quickly switch between different cutting tasks and tooling, reducing setup times. It can also operate continuously, increasing overall production output. For example, in a cabinet-making workshop, the CNC Cutting Machine can cut all the necessary parts for multiple cabinets in a short time, streamlining the production process and ensuring timely delivery of orders.
